Why These Are the Top Home Security Contractors in Cedarpines Park

The home security market in Cedarpines Park is characterized by service from established regional and national providers rather than local, brick-and-mortar stores within the community itself. Due to its rural, mountainous location, the market has moderate competition, with a few key players dominating the service area. The quality of service is generally high, but residents may experience slightly higher costs or longer scheduling times for installations and service calls compared to urban areas, reflecting travel time for technicians. Typical pricing for a professionally installed system with 24/7 monitoring ranges from $30 to $60 per month, with initial equipment and installation costs often ranging from $0 to $1,500, depending on promotions and system complexity. Companies like Mountain Alarm, which have strong regional reputations, are often preferred for their perceived reliability and local knowledge of the specific challenges (e.g., weather, connectivity) in mountain communities.

1How does living in a high-fire-risk area like Cedarpines Park affect my home security system choice and installation?

Given Cedarpines Park's designation as a Very High Fire Hazard Severity Zone (VHFHSZ), your security system should integrate with wildfire preparedness. Opt for providers offering cellular and battery backup to maintain operation during PSPS (Public Safety Power Shutoff) events. Additionally, consider systems with environmental sensors (smoke/heat) that provide immediate alerts to both you and monitoring centers, which is critical for early evacuation in our mountainous, brush-heavy community.

2What is the typical cost range for installing and monitoring a home security system in Cedarpines Park?

Installation costs in our area typically range from $0 to $1,500, depending on equipment and whether you choose professional or DIY setup. Monthly monitoring fees generally run between $30 and $60. Be aware that due to our rural, forested location, some national providers may charge additional travel fees for installation and service calls, so always request a localized quote that includes any potential "remote area" surcharges.

3Are there any specific permits or regulations from San Bernardino County for installing home security systems in Cedarpines Park?

San Bernardino County does not require a general permit for installing standard alarm systems. However, if your installation involves significant electrical work or structural modifications, a building permit may be needed. Crucially, you must register your alarm system with the San Bernardino County Sheriff's Department; false alarm fines can be substantial, and registration is often required by monitoring companies before they will dispatch authorities.

4What seasonal considerations should I account for with my security system in the San Bernardino Mountains?

Our climate demands seasonal vigilance. In winter, ensure outdoor cameras and sensors are rated for freezing temperatures and heavy rain or snow, and keep pathways to equipment clear for service. In the dry summer and fall fire season, regularly clear brush and debris from around external motion sensors and cameras to prevent false alarms and ensure clear sightlines. Power and internet reliability can fluctuate seasonally, making robust backup systems essential.

5How do I choose a reliable provider given Cedarpines Park's remote, mountainous setting?

Prioritize providers with proven local experience and reliable cellular-based monitoring, as landline and internet service can be less dependable here. Ask specifically about their average response time for service calls to our area and the strength of their cellular backup during outages. Checking with neighbors in local community groups or Nextdoor for recommendations is invaluable, as local experience with a provider's equipment performance in our unique environment is the best indicator of reliability.
